Part-Time Plastic Injection Machine Operator
-Mon-Wed 4:30pm-9:30pm in Comstock Park, MI. You’ll support consistent output by running assigned tasks to spec and keeping pace with the team’s goals.
- Monitor molding machines and verify molded parts meet quality standards
- Inspect product, complete basic assembly, and judge acceptability using GMPs and written procedures
- Follow job-specific work instructions for sorting, packaging, and labeling/identification
- Use measurement scales to track production accurately
- High School Diploma or equivalent
- Effective oral communication, time management, and problem-solving
- Positive teamwork skills with the ability to work independently
- Reliable and willing to stay to get the job done
